As the chill of winter gives way to the renewal of spring, it's the perfect time to assess your home's exterior. Winter often leaves behind salt residue and dirt, which can be easily addressed by pressure washing. This process not only cleans your surfaces but also prepares them for a fresh coat of paint if necessary. Removing grime prevents long-term damage, such as mold and mildew, which can degrade surfaces over time.
Spring's mild temperatures offer an excellent window for exterior painting. Before you start, inspect your walls for any peeling or cracking paint. This could indicate that moisture has penetrated the existing paint layer, a situation that should be remedied before it worsens. Repainting your home not only refreshes its appearance but also provides a protective barrier against future weathering. Choosing high-quality paint will ensure durability, standing up to the harsh elements each season brings.
As summer arrives, the focus should shift slightly. While the drier weather is ideal for painting, it's crucial to avoid the hottest parts of the day. Paint can dry too quickly under intense heat, leading to a less-than-perfect finish. This season also allows homeowners to tackle larger projects without the threat of unexpected rain. It's also a good time for refreshing decks and wooden surfaces; a fresh stain or sealant can prevent UV damage and other weather-related wear.
Fall brings cooler temperatures and is another excellent opportunity for painting. Early to mid-fall provides the best conditions—cool but not cold air, and generally fewer precipitation days. These conditions help paint adhere better, ensuring a longer-lasting finish. Use this time to also inspect your home's pressure-washed surfaces from spring, ensuring they're still in good condition before winter's harshness sets in.
